Vintage READ Posters Auctioned as American Library Association Turns 150
Heritage Auctions is selling over 200 posters from the American Library Association's READ campaign in an online auction running from June 18 to July 10, 2026, commemorating the ALA's 150th anniversary. The campaign, launched over 40 years ago, features celebrities and fictional characters posing with their favorite books under the word "READ." Notable participants include Paul Newman, Spike Lee, Shaquille O'Neal, Oprah Winfrey, Elvis Presley, David Bowie, Yo-Yo Ma, and the Muppets. Casts from "Glee" and "Buffy the Vampire Slayer" also appear. ALA president Sam Helmick highlighted the campaign's role in promoting literacy across generations. The ALA was founded in 1876 at the first Convention of Librarians in Philadelphia by 103 librarians. The organization exhibited at the 1893 World's Fair, publishes Booklist magazine, established the Newbery Medal, and tracks book bans. The READ campaign inspired university spin-offs. An exhibition at Poster House in New York, "Reading Under Fire: Arming Minds & Hearts During Wartime," explores earlier literacy posters. During World War I, the ALA supplied millions of books to troops. A high-bid poster shows Paul Newman reading Star Warriors on a pool table. Heritage Auctions' Charles Epting called the posters cultural touchstones that made reading exciting.
